Posted by Red's Place Custom & Restoration  -  04/17/2008 06:44 AM
Sem is a qualilty flat black paint it is pricey but holds up extremely well I have been using it fo sometime now and it is the only semi gloss or flat black that doesn't turn chalky or spot from grease or fingerprint. Posted by roadsterboy  -  04/17/2008 03:44 PM
Eric, Did a flat black roadster last summer with kirker. painted chassis first and assembled chassis while painting body. Painted the body and all the panels at the same time some of the parts looked like they "blushed" or had a whitish look to them in some areas but not entire panels. Ended up blowing the car apart to repaint including chassis which was a running , plumbed chassis. I usually spray Spies Hecker only but had read some good things about kircker, Will never stray again. Spies has a really nice "rallye black" that lays flat and has a real nice semi-gloss. This is a single stage urethane with flattner already mixed in.
